LONDON (Bywire News) - Eight months after it pivoted to become an NFT platform for creators, Voice.com is celebrating a major milestone as it becomes carbon negative. The news comes on the eve of Earth Month and demonstrates that it is possible to create web 3.0 technologies that protect the environment. 

Voice.com has achieved this goal by pledging to support reforestation projects. For every NFT created on their platform, they have promised to plant a tree. This effort, they say, will take them into carbon-neutral territory for the first time. 

"Every NFT minted on Voice is already carbon neutral, so we're focused on reforestation and moving towards carbon negativity," says Salah Zalatimo, CEO of Voice. "Building a sustainable NFT ecosystem can't be done only by offsetting.  We must also build a greener future."

From day one, Voice.com set out to create an NFT platform which was environmentally friendly, easy to use, robust, portable and decentralised. It runs on a private EOSIO blockchain which differs from major blockchains such as Ethereum and Bitcoin in that it is carbon neutral. 

It does this thanks to its distributed proof of stake model which does not require large server farms to work. In dPOS block producers take turns to produce their blocks without needing to solve complex mathematical problems as under proof of work. The only power involved with dPOS is the energy used to add blocks of transactions to the blockchain. 

This is key given controversies over the vast carbon footprint of the two biggest blockchains. EOSIO with its proof of stake model has the massive advantage of being entirely carbon neutral which means any further activity allows it to claim a net positive impact on the environment. 

To run their reforestation efforts Voice has partnered with Ecologi, a platform for real climate action. It facilitates the funding of carbon offset projects such as tree planting around the world. 

Throughout April, all trees which are planted on behalf of the Voice community will be transparently viewable on the platform's virtual forest.

“We are delighted that Voice has partnered with us to celebrate Earth Month, pledging to plant a tree for every NFT created on their platform in April," says Linda Adams, Head of Partnerships, Ecologi. "By pioneering the world's first eco-friendly blockchain technology, and by encouraging other platforms to take responsibility for their emissions, Voice's dedication to changing this notoriously energy-intensive industry is remarkable.”

Aside from its reforestation efforts, Voice is also supporting the Capricorn Ridge Wind Project, a wind generation plant in Texas. The company also partnered with Google Cloud to ensure data usage is not just carbon neutral, but carbon negative. 

At a time when blockchain technology is facing heavy criticism over its environmental impact, then, Voice.com and EOS as a whole, are demonstrating that another vision is possible.
